Ce este precalcularea? Definiție, beneficii și aplicații
Precalculat se referă la procesul de calcul și stocare a rezultatelor unui calcul în avans, astfel încât acestea să poată fi recuperate rapid și reutilizate ulterior. Cu alte cuvinte, precalcularea implică efectuarea unui calcul o dată și stocarea rezultatelor, mai degrabă decât efectuarea calculului de fiecare dată când este necesar.
Precalcularea poate fi utilă din mai multe motive, cum ar fi:
1. Reducerea sarcinii de calcul: prin precalcularea rezultatelor unui calcul, putem evita să fie necesar să efectuați calculul de fiecare dată când este necesar, ceea ce poate economisi timp și reduce cheltuielile de calcul.
2. Îmbunătățirea performanței: rezultatele precalculate pot fi stocate în memorie sau pe disc, permițându-le să fie recuperate și utilizate rapid, ceea ce poate îmbunătăți performanța.
3. Activarea procesării offline: prin precalcularea rezultatelor unui calcul, putem activa procesarea offline, unde rezultatele sunt calculate în avans și stocate pentru utilizare ulterioară.
4. Sprijinirea aplicațiilor în timp real: Precalcularea poate fi utilă în aplicațiile în timp real, unde rezultatele unui calcul trebuie să fie rapid disponibile.
5. Reducerea transferului de date: prin precalcularea rezultatelor unui calcul, putem reduce cantitatea de date care trebuie transferată între diferite componente ale unui sistem, ceea ce poate îmbunătăți performanța și poate reduce supraîncărcarea rețelei.
Rezultatele precalculate pot fi stocate în diferite forme, cum ar fi ca:
1. Matrice sau matrice: Rezultatele precalculate pot fi stocate în matrice sau matrice, unde fiecare element reprezintă rezultatul unui anumit calcul.
2. Structuri de date: Rezultatele precalculate pot fi stocate și în structuri de date mai complexe, cum ar fi arbori sau grafice, care permit regăsirea și manipularea eficientă a rezultatelor.
3. Fișiere: rezultatele precalculate pot fi stocate și în fișiere, unde fișierul conține rezultatele precalculate într-un anumit format.
4. Memorie: rezultatele precalculate pot fi, de asemenea, stocate în memorie, unde sunt accesibile rapid și pot fi folosite pentru a îmbunătăți performanța.
5. Cloud: rezultatele precalculate pot fi stocate și în cloud, unde pot fi accesate de pe diferite dispozitive și locații.